@import"https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@400;500;600;700&family=Instrument+Serif:ital@0;1&display=swap";*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}:root{--font-mono: "JetBrains Mono", "SF Mono", "Fira Code", monospace;--font-serif: "Instrument Serif", Georgia, serif;--text-xs: .65rem;--text-sm: .75rem;--text-base: .85rem;--text-lg: 1rem;--text-xl: 1.25rem;--text-2xl: 1.5rem;--text-3xl: 2rem;--text-4xl: 2.5rem;--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-5: 1.25rem;--space-6: 1.5rem;--space-8: 2rem;--space-10: 2.5rem;--space-12: 3rem;--radius-sm: 2px;--radius-md: 4px;--radius-lg: 8px;--radius-full: 9999px;--transition-fast: .15s ease;--transition-base: .2s ease;--transition-slow: .3s ease;--green: #2ECC71;--green-dim: #00C49A;--orange: #FFB020;--orange-dim: #d97706;--red: #FF4D4D;--blue: #3399FF;--violet: #9D8CFF;--pink: #FF66C4;--shadow-sm: 0 1px 2px rgba(0, 0, 0, .05);--shadow-md: 0 4px 6px rgba(0, 0, 0, .1);--shadow-lg: 0 10px 15px rgba(0, 0, 0, .1);--shadow-glow-green: 0 0 20px rgba(0, 196, 154, .3)}:root,[data-theme=light]{--bg-primary: #e8e8e8;--bg-secondary: #dedede;--bg-tertiary: #d4d4d4;--bg-inverse: #0e1016;--text-primary: #1a1a1a;--text-secondary: #3d3d3d;--text-tertiary: #5a5a5a;--text-inverse: #e8e8e8;--text-inverse-secondary: #a0a0a0;--border: #c8c8c8;--border-strong: #a8a8a8;--gray-100: #e0e0e0;--gray-200: #d4d4d4;--gray-300: #c8c8c8;--gray-400: #a8a8a8;--gray-500: #888888;--gray-600: #5a5a5a;--gray-700: #3d3d3d;--gray-800: #2a2a2a;--gray-900: #1a1a1a;--logo-invert: 0}[data-theme=dark]{--bg-primary: #0e1016;--bg-secondary: #151820;--bg-tertiary: #1c202a;--bg-inverse: #ffffff;--text-primary: #e2e4e9;--text-secondary: #9aa3b5;--text-tertiary: #6b7489;--text-inverse: #0c0e14;--text-inverse-secondary: #4a4a4a;--border: #2a3042;--border-strong: #3d4558;--gray-100: #0f1218;--gray-200: #181c25;--gray-300: #2a3142;--gray-400: #3d4559;--gray-500: #5a6478;--gray-600: #8892a6;--gray-700: #b8c0d0;--gray-800: #dce1eb;--gray-900: #f0f2f5;--logo-invert: 1}html{font-size:14px;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;scroll-behavior:smooth}body{font-family:var(--font-mono);background-color:var(--bg-primary);color:var(--text-primary);line-height:1.5;min-height:100vh}h1,h2,h3{font-family:var(--font-serif);font-weight:400}a{color:inherit;text-decoration:none;transition:color var(--transition-fast)}a:hover{color:var(--green-dim)}.btn{display:inline-flex;align-items:center;justify-content:center;gap:var(--space-2);padding:var(--space-3) var(--space-5);font-family:var(--font-mono);font-size:var(--text-sm);font-weight:500;text-transform:uppercase;letter-spacing:.05em;border:1px solid var(--text-primary);background:transparent;color:var(--text-primary);cursor:pointer;transition:all var(--transition-fast)}.btn:hover{background:var(--text-primary);color:var(--bg-primary)}.btn-primary{border-color:var(--green-dim);color:var(--green-dim)}.btn-primary:hover{background:var(--green-dim);color:var(--bg-primary);box-shadow:var(--shadow-glow-green)}.btn-ghost{border-color:transparent}.btn-ghost:hover{border-color:var(--border);background:transparent;color:var(--text-primary)}.btn-sm{padding:var(--space-2) var(--space-3);font-size:var(--text-xs)}.btn-lg{padding:var(--space-4) var(--space-6);font-size:var(--text-base)}.card{background:var(--bg-secondary);border:1px solid var(--border);padding:var(--space-5);transition:all var(--transition-fast)}.card-interactive{cursor:pointer}.card-interactive:hover{border-color:var(--text-primary)}.card-selected{border-color:var(--green-dim);background:#00c49a0d}.status-dot{width:6px;height:6px;border-radius:50%;display:inline-block}.status-dot.active{background:var(--green);animation:pulse 2s infinite}.status-dot.pending{background:var(--orange)}.status-dot.error{background:var(--red)}@keyframes pulse{0%,to{opacity:1}50%{opacity:.4}}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:var(--bg-secondary)}::-webkit-scrollbar-thumb{background:var(--gray-400);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--gray-500)}.text-green{color:var(--green)}.text-teal{color:var(--green-dim)}.text-orange{color:var(--orange)}.text-red{color:var(--red)}.text-muted{color:var(--text-secondary)}.font-mono{font-family:var(--font-mono)}.font-serif{font-family:var(--font-serif)}.uppercase{text-transform:uppercase}.tracking-wide{letter-spacing:.1em}
